Hearts were pounding faster and all eyes were on screen waiting to see who would be declared as Kids Champion 2008. Each contestant performed to their excellence and the competition was so close that it was difficult to assume which one would be the final winner but there was one contestant who stood out not only in dance performance but also in the noble work that she has been doing from her early childhood. Before I write the winners name, I would like to salute the energies and the determination that all the kids showed. A job Very Well Done!

And the winner is………… "ISHA DANG" from Patiala.

This 14 year old performed gracefully and mesmerized all the viewers and the judges. She was the one who got the best of comments from judges yesterday and the biggest of them all was when Javed said he was lost in her dance. Now that is what I call a performance. If a judge like Javed Jaaferi can be lost in a performance then that dancer not only deserves the crown but also a standing ovation.

BoogieWoogieIndia.Com Congratulates Isha Dang. We are PROUD of you.  And keep it up with all the Charity work that you do.  God Bless You!

1 Today the remaining four gave a tough fight to win the crown of Kids Championship 2008 title.

9 18 The first one to come was Girishma Yadav. This 11 year old danced on Kailash Kher’s number “Preet ki lat mohe aisi laagi”. We heard this song many times in singing reality shows but this was the first time we saw a dancer danced to this number. She performed really good but then as the judges said this was not the number to be chosen for the finals. Good try though and Well done Girishma!

24 28 Next finalist who performed beautifully and gracefully was 14 year old Tulika Tripathy. She danced on “More Piya”. Her moves, her expressions and everything she did was superb. When you watch the video, you simply are going to love it. She also came with a number of riddles for the judges and lightened the atmosphere. She is a bundle of joy and her parents must be very proud of her. I am sure the entire Boogie Woogie unit and viewers are proud of her. Way to go Tulika - Never change and always be the jovial you! Well Done!

42 34 Alright now it was time for little energetic doll Farhina Parvez to perform. She suprised everyone by performing on a number that was not her forte. Many had put their money down that she will perform a rocking hip hop number that will tear the stage away but we were in for a surprize. As everyone knows Farhina is a hip hop dancer and today she performed a semi classical Indian dance - a song chosen from the movie “Chandramukhi”. They used beautiful props and everything matched perfect to her dance. Judges did question her why she chose to perform a number that belonged to a different jonar and to this her choreographer and teacher responded saying he wanted to present a complete dancer instead of presenting one style of dance. A interesting and bold thought but was it required at this level? Maybe not and the judges objected to this point of view but I felt her performance and the risk she took was very well worth it. I was extremely happy to see the Indian dancer in Farhina. Winning is not all and she is very talented young lady and sure has a long way to go. I wouldn’t be surprised if I see her as a successful superstar tomorrow. Oh did I tell you she was looking absolutely stunning. Yes she was. Great work Farhina - Very Well Done!

58 56 Last one to perform in this Grand Finale was little master Abhash Mukherjee. This 12 year old danced superbly on a Telugu song and the entry he made was just perfect. The judges themselves were impressed and praised for the steps and moves that he took. A very enjoyable number of course! I was expecting perfect remarks but then as the judges sure know their art a lot better then me so I salute them for pointing out the stuff and for their perfection and fairness. The way  they look at things which people like you and me cannot even observe is worth a big applaud. But nevertheless a great performance so Bravo Abhash!

43 First one to perform today was Khushbu Kadam in Kids Championship. This 13 year performed gracefully on “Saanso ki maala” from movie Koyla. When she was asked what she thinks about her own performance, she said she was not totally satisfied and felt her energies were little less. She was modest and sweet.

19 Next one to perform energetically was Sahil Tyagi who hails from Saharanpur. He performed on a number “Door se paas bulane aaye”. I am not sure which movie this song is from but his dancing moves were fabulous. His performance started with a little Boogie Woogie title song and then it was remixed with the above number.

66 Third participant in Friday’s episode was pretty lady Sriya Salini Sahu who danced absolutely graceful on one of the golden oldies “Raat ka Sama” from movie Ziddi from year 1964. Her dance moves were in perfect synch with rhythm. She also mimicked an old lady and her mother gave her company too.

69 Now it was turn for the little angel who does lot of charities at this young age. Isha Dang from Patiala who is 14 year old. She danced an absolutely mesmerizing classical number on “Mohe panghat pe nandlal” from movie Moghul e Azam. She got the best of comments from the judges. As a matter of fact Javed said he was lost in her performance. I think this is the best comment any performer could ever wish for. Well Done Isha!!

Tomorrow we shall see the remaining four finalists perform - Farhina Parvez, Abhash Mukherjee, Tulika Tripaty and Girishma Yadav.
